Реклама в Telegram-каналах DzikPic и dev.by теперь дешевле. Узнать подробности 👨🏻‍💻
Support us

Память

Оставить комментарий
Память
Не так давно, по меркам обычного времени, и много лет назад, по меркам течения времени в ИТ было время, когда возможности стационарных компьютеров были ограничены, да и не у каждого жителя постсоветского пространства имелся оный девайс. В те времена также были программисты, люди также писали некое ПО и все пытались втиснуть большие неповоротливые приложения в возможности железа на тот момент. Занимались оптимизацией, даже проводились чемпионаты по созданию демо-сцен, размер исполняемого файла, и количество занимаемой оперативной памяти были не последними факторами, определяющими победителя. Но технологии не стояли на месте, с каждым днем возможностей становится все больше, и вот сейчас уже никого не волнует количество съедаемой оперативки, да и актуально ли это в настоящий момент, когда планка стоит около 20 долларов. Если раньше разработчики подстраивались под пользователей пытаясь запустить и оптимизировать созданные приложения под машины юзеров, то сейчас наблюдается обратная тенденция. Не запускается? Купи больше памяти, я уже не говорю про геймдев, где за новинками юзеры просто не успевают Проведем эксперимент, запускаем:
  • VS 2010 Team Beta 1
  • VS2008 Professional Edition
  • Microsoft Expression Blend 3
В каждом из них я создал по новому проекту, в итоге все они потребляют больше всего памяти в системе, более 120Мб каждое приложение, причем это не в работе. В процессе работы Blend у меня отъел в сумме около 600Мб, после часа отладки в VS2010 около 400Мб, чуть меньше показатели у VS2009 около 300Мб. Быть может это плата за применение новых технологий? Как известно Blend и VS2010 написаны на WPF. Я работаю, на мой взгляд, на довольно хорошей машине с 2Гб оперативки Windows XP Prof и Intel Core 2 Duo, и выделение памяти при работе с данными приложениями превышает 2Гб. Причем сама ОС отъедает около 500-600Мб. Конечно, выбранные продукты не единичны, список можно продолжать до бесконечности. Так куда же мы все-таки движемся, если количество потребляемой ОП становиться платой за применение новых технологий. А быть может в ближайшем будущем стационарные компьютере будут больше похожи на серверы с 17Гб оперативки?
Новый рекламный формат в наших телеграм-каналах.

Купить 500 символов за $150

Читайте также
Создана первая в мире карта памяти на 1,5 Тбайт
Создана первая в мире карта памяти на 1,5 Тбайт
Создана первая в мире карта памяти на 1,5 Тбайт
Как запоминать сотни задач и не сойти с ума: Getting Things Done и Zettelkasten
Как запоминать сотни задач и не сойти с ума: Getting Things Done и Zettelkasten
Bubble
Как запоминать сотни задач и не сойти с ума: Getting Things Done и Zettelkasten
Маск говорит, что каждый ребёнок должен знать и избегать эти 50 когнитивных искажений
Маск говорит, что каждый ребёнок должен знать и избегать эти 50 когнитивных искажений
Маск говорит, что каждый ребёнок должен знать и избегать эти 50 когнитивных искажений
4 комментария
Ученые создали память, которая передает данные и светом, и электричеством
Ученые создали память, которая передает данные и светом, и электричеством
Ученые создали память, которая передает данные и светом, и электричеством

Хотите сообщить важную новость? Пишите в Telegram-бот

Главные события и полезные ссылки в нашем Telegram-канале

Обсуждение
Комментируйте без ограничений

Релоцировались? Теперь вы можете комментировать без верификации аккаунта.

Комментариев пока нет.